◆ divide()

ring_elem FractionField::divide ( const ring_elem f,
const ring_elem g ) const
virtual

Implements Ring.

Definition at line 589 of file frac.cpp.

590{
591 frac_elem *f = FRAC_VAL(a);
592 frac_elem *g = FRAC_VAL(b);
593 ring_elem top = R_->mult(f->numer, g->denom);
594 ring_elem bottom = R_->mult(f->denom, g->numer);
595
596 if (R_->is_zero(bottom)) return set_non_unit_frac(f->denom);
597
598 return FRAC_RINGELEM(make_elem(top, bottom));
599}
